Maharashtra HSC Result 2025: Girls Outshine Boys As Overall Pass Percentage Touches 91.88%

Mumbai: The Maharashtra State Board of Secondary and Higher Secondary Education (MSBSHSE) on Monday declared the HSC Class 12 exam results for the academic year 2024-25, registering an impressive overall pass percentage of 91.88%. The results are now available on the board’s official websites including mahresult.nic.in, mahahsscboard.in, and other affiliated platforms.
In a consistent trend, girls outperformed boys this year as well. The pass percentage for girls stood at 94.58%, while boys recorded an 89.51% pass rate.
Stream-wise Performance
According to MSBSHSE data:
-
Science stream led the chart with a pass percentage of 97.35%.
-
Commerce stream followed with 92.38%, while
-
Arts stream registered 80.52%.
-
The vocational stream saw 83.26% students passing.
Private candidates also showed encouraging results, with 83.73% of the 36,133 registered candidates clearing the exams.
Notably, 37 subjects among the 154 offered had a 100% pass rate, indicating strong performance in specific academic areas.
Differently-Abled Candidates
A total of 7,310 differently-abled students appeared for the HSC examination this year. Of these, 6,705 cleared the exam, marking a commendable pass percentage of 92.38% in this category.

About the HSC Exam 2025
The HSC examinations were conducted from February 11 to March 11, 2025, earlier than usual. Over 15 lakh Class 12 students appeared this year, including 6,94,652 girls, 8,10,348 boys, and 37 transgender students.
In total, over 31 lakh students registered for both SSC and HSC exams, reflecting the state’s vast education infrastructure and participation.
